Pivot window repair services involve fixing or replacing the movable sash or frame of a pivot window to restore proper function and appearance. These repairs often address issues such as difficulty opening or closing the window, sticking sashes, or misaligned frames. Skilled contractors can handle a range of problems, including broken or damaged pivot hardware, warped or rotting frames, and broken glass. Proper repair work ensures the window operates smoothly, maintains its aesthetic appeal, and continues to provide reliable ventilation and natural light for the property.
Many common problems can be resolved through pivot window repair, helping homeowners avoid the need for full window replacement. For example, a window that is difficult to operate might be due to worn-out hardware or misaligned pivots, which local service providers can fix or replace. Additionally, issues like drafts or leaks often stem from damaged seals or warped frames that can be corrected during repairs. Addressing these problems promptly can improve energy efficiency, prevent further damage, and extend the lifespan of the window.

The overview below groups typical Pivot Window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Longview, WA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or window repairs, such as replacing broken glass or fixing a loose sash, generally range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of the damage and window size.
Full Window Replacement - Replacing an entire window can vary widely, with local contractors often charging between $800 and $2,500 for standard-sized units. Larger or more complex projects, like custom or energy-efficient windows, can reach $3,500 or more.
Hardware and Lock Repairs - Repairing or replacing window hardware, such as locks or latches, typically costs between $100 and $300. These smaller projects are common and usually fall into the lower end of the cost spectrum.
Large or Custom Projects - Extensive repairs or custom window installations in Longview and nearby areas can range from $2,000 to over $5,000, with fewer projects reaching into the highest tiers depending on complexity and materials involved.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
